npm install --save @types/pathval
This package contains type definitions for pathval (https://www.npmjs.com/package/pathval).
Files were exported from https://github.com/DefinitelyTyped/DefinitelyTyped/tree/master/types/pathval.
1export interface PathInfo { 2 parent: object; 3 name: string; 4 value?: any; 5 exists: boolean; 6} 7 8export type Property = string | symbol | number; 9 10export function hasProperty(obj: object | undefined | null, name: Property): boolean; 11export function getPathInfo(obj: object, path: string): PathInfo; 12export function getPathValue(obj: object, path: string): object | undefined; 13export function setPathValue(obj: object, path: string, val: any): object; 14 15export as namespace pathval; 16
These definitions were written by Rebecca Turner.
